The Epic E40L is a lifted, four-seat electric golf cart that’s built to be street-legal in many areas and designed for neighborhood cruising, community use, and light-terrain driving.


Expert Review Summary

According to the latest expert rating, the Epic E40L scores an overall 4.7 out of 5 stars — a strong rating for performance, features, and value.

Key features highlighted include:

  • Electric powertrain: 6.3 kW AC brushless motor with smooth acceleration and quiet operation.

  • Lifted suspension: Provides better ground clearance and a more stable ride.

  • Street-legal capability: With DOT-compliant lighting, signals, and seat belts.

  • Modern tech: 10.1″ digital touchscreen display, Bluetooth audio, USB charging, backup camera.

  • Range & battery: 35–50 mile range on lithium battery packs (depending on terrain and load).

Some of the minor drawbacks mentioned in expert reviews are that the lifted design can slightly reduce range compared with lower-sitting carts, and there may be fewer aftermarket customization options compared to more mainstream brands.


Real-World Owner Feedback (Informal)

Online community comments show a mix of user experiences — which can help give additional context beyond official specs:

  • Some owners report battery or performance issues, particularly with AGM batteries on older models, and mention that parts/support can be slow or difficult without a strong dealer relationship.

  • A few users have discussed speed limiting or power-drop behavior when driving for extended periods, suggesting that proper servicing may be needed to diagnose faults.

  • In some cases, community members note suspension alignment concerns at highway-lite speeds (22–25 mph), with fixes often requiring dealer adjustment.

These comments are anecdotal and vary widely — good dealer support and proper maintenance tend to be key contributors to owner satisfaction.


Build and Feature Highlights

Across multiple listings and spec sources, the E40L is consistently described as offering:

  • 14″ aluminum wheels with street tires for everyday use.

  • LED lighting and signal systems for visibility and compliance.

  • Diamond-stitched high-back seats and a lifted stance for comfort and style.

  • Backup camera and Bluetooth sound system as standard tech features.

These elements give the E40L a “neighborhood electric vehicle” feel rather than a bare-bones utility cart.


Bottom Line

Epic E40L is often praised for delivering a solid mix of comfort, modern features, and utility at a competitive price point, especially for buyers who want a well-equipped electric cart with street-legal capability and upgraded tech.


However, prospective buyers should be mindful that after-sales support and dealer relationships can significantly impact the ownership experience, and community feedback on battery longevity and service responsiveness varies.
